Rip married Millie Israel in 1952, and she passed away in 1996. Later, in 1996 he married Marie Gillespie, and she passed away earlier this year.
He served in the U.S. Army as a paratrooper and cook in the Korean War. Later Rip worked at Ford Motor Company, Kansas City.
Others who preceded him in death were his parents, and eight siblings.
Survivors are a son, Charles R. (Melody) of Smithville, Mo.; two grandsons, Grant and Seth Metcalf, both of Kansas City, Mo.
A graveside service will be held at 1:00 p.m., Wednesday, May 10, 2017 in Wright Cemetery, with Pastor Lee Miller officiating, under the direction of Meadors Funeral Home, Republic, Mo.
